INTELLIGENT PARKING ASSIST SYSTEM DIAGNOSIS SYSTEM


  1. INTELLIGENT PARKING ASSIST OR DIAGNOSIS SYSTEM


    1. For intelligent parking assist system diagnosis, signals received by the parking assist ECU can be checked and the intelligent parking assist system can be calibrated, adjusted and checked using the radio and display receiver assembly*1 or navigation receiver assembly*2.

  7. STEERING ANGLE SETTING (after parking assist ECU is initialized)

    Tech Tips

    If the vehicle width extension lines and predicted path lines are not aligned when the steering wheel is centered, or if the predicted path lines stop moving before the steering wheel is fully turned to either the left or right, adjust the steering angle settings.


    1. Center the steering wheel and stop the vehicle.

    3. A005BJA

      Steering angle setting


      1. Check that the steering wheel is centered (approximately +/- 5 degrees or less) and select "STEERING CENTER MEMORIZE".

      2. After the centered steering position is memorized, turn the steering wheel to the left and then to the right full lock positions and select "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E".

        Tech Tips

        It is also possible to start by initially turning the steering wheel to the right side.

      3. Select "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" to store the steering angle adjustment values and change the screen to the "MODE SETTING" screen.

        Tech Tips


        • When "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" is selected, a beep will sound to confirm that the steering angle adjustment values have been stored.

        • The adjustment values will not be stored unless "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" is selected.

        • The values are not stored until the beep has sounded.

        • When "BACK" is selected, the screen changes to "SIGNAL CHECK" without storing the set values.

        • If "OK" is selected without selecting "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E", the values will not be stored (Change the screen to the "MODE SETTING" screen).

        • If the steering angle settings have not been adjusted, selecting "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" will not cause values to be stored.

        • Even if no DTCs are detected, selecting "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" may not cause the values to be stored if the steering sensor is malfunctioning.

        • If selecting "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" does not cause the values to be stored after performing the steering angle setting procedure, replace the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ly Click here.

    5. Confirm steering angle adjustment.

      Tech Tips

      If the steering angle setting procedure has been performed, confirm the steering angle adjustment using the intelligent parking assist screen after finishing diagnosis mode.


      1. Check on the intelligent parking assist screen that the predicted path line moves until the steering wheel is fully turned to either the left or right.

        Tech Tips

        If the predicted path line stops moving before the steering wheel is fully turned to either the left or right, the values have not been stored correctly. In this case, perform "STEERING CENTER MEMORIZE" and "MAX STEERING ANGLE MEMORIZE" again.

    2. A005BJT

      PARALLEL PARKING OFFSET

      Tech Tips

      The "PARALLEL PARKING OFFSET" screen allows the parking position to be offset when the actual parking position deviates to the right or left of the set target parking position during parallel parking mode.


      1. Press "UP" or "DOWN" to adjust the parallel parking position horizontal offset amount.

        A005DK9E05

        Tech Tips


        • Positive values are indicated in green and negative values are indicated in red.

        • The + direction indicates an offset toward the edge of the road, the - direction indicates an offset toward the center of the road.

        • When the value is shown as "10 CM" in red, it means -10 cm (the parking position is offset 10 cm towards the center of the road).

        • Available setting range: +20 cm to -40 cm (can be adjusted in 1 cm increments)

      2. When "OK" is selected, the screen switches to the signal connection screen and a set value is stored.


        • When "OK" is selected, the value is stored after a beep sounds for confirmation.

        • The value will not be stored unless "OK" is selected.

        • The value is not stored until the beep has sounded.

        • When "BACK" is selected, the screen switches to the signal connection screen without storing the value (value entered is not stored).
